Camp Registrar

YMCA of Metropolitan ChicagoBurlington, WI
$21 - $22

About The Position

Under the supervision of the Camp Executive Director, the Camp Registrar administers and directs all facets of the Camp MacLean program registration process. The responsibilities of this part-time position include but are not limited to frontline customer service and sales representation, assist with camper sales, managing camper registrations, revenue processing, basic accounting transactions, logistical processing of marketing mailings, accurate record keeping and filing, and management of office machines and supplies. Carry out the mission of YMCA Camp MacLean. While reporting to the Executive Director, the Camp Registrar works closely with the YMCA Finance Department. The pay rate is $21.00-$22.00 per hour. This is a temporary, part-time position with a Monday-Friday schedule. Our staff is the Y's greatest asset. Requirements

  • Must be 18 years or older
  • Minimum requirements include High School Diploma plus at least three years of experience in camp operations, office administration, sales, and/or experience in general bookkeeping.
  • Previous sales/customer service experience required.
  • Well-developed writing skills required.
  • Must have proficiency in Microsoft Word, excel, power point or similar software programs.
  • Ability to work with other seasonal and/or full-time business office staff is required.
  • Must be an energetic person committed to the YMCA mission.
  • This position requires excellent organizational and communication skills.
  • Monday thru Friday

Nice To Haves

  • Experience and strong knowledge of social media is a preferred.

Responsibilities

  • Ensure proper following of all procedures, policies and public relations at all times
  • Act as a team member, working closely with other staff on all interrelated matters
  • In conjunction with the camp program director, co-administrates and assists with the selling of camp sessions
  • First line communication to all MacLean constituents
  • Develop relationships with MacLean customers, be attentive to their needs
  • Answer phones with a strong emphasis on customer service
  • Oversee and manage the camper registration process for resident, day, winter and family camp programs; Assist as needed in managing the group service calendar, writing and distributing user group agreements.
  • Administer financial transactions related to revenue; responsible for bank deposits
  • Administer and manage basic financial accounts for campers and guests
  • Responsible for camp mail distribution and delivery
  • Responsible for the technical & logistical processing all marketing initiatives and mailings
  • Maintain and manage camper database; compile statistical data as needed
  • Assist in training the summer office administrative aide
  • Work with the year-round business office to make sure all business functions are professional, efficient and accurate
  • Responsible for office supply inventory, purchasing and distribution of supplies
  • Responsible for maintaining accurate files and records
  • Responsible for overseeing the maintenance and functionality of all office equipment including copiers, phone systems etc.
  • All other duties as assigned
